Celer Network Overview
What is Celer Network?
Celer Network was founded by four co-founders – Dr Qingkai Liang from MIT, Dr. Xiaozhou Li from Princeton University, Dr. Junda from UC Berkeley, and Dr. Mo Dong from UIUC – in 2018. It is the most advanced off-chain layer-2 scaling platform. The unique designation of Celet Network can be deployed to commit fast, low-cost, interoperable, and secure transactions for purchases and smart contracts. The project’s core theme is getting mass adoption for blockchain, meanwhile providing cost-efficient applications on Ethereum, Polkadot, etc., by incorporating the State channel and Layer-2 roll-up.
How does it work?
As mentioned, Celer Network aims to deploy blockchain such as Ethereum or Polkadot as its Layer 1. This notion aims to increase developers’ experiences as they don’t have to master a new technology stack.
The Celer Network’s Cstack architecture comprises three components: cOS, cRoute, and cChannel.
- cOS: A development framework and runtime for applications utilising State Channel. It provides standard design principles and oversees off-chain state operations, storage, tracking, and dispute resolution.
- cRoute: A decentralised system for generalised conditional value routing across a network comprising multiple chains and layers. It is designed to be fully decentralised, ensuring high resilience against failures.
- cChannel: The foundational layer that interacts with various blockchains. It offers the upper layer a unified abstraction of current states and time-bounded finality. Leveraging state channel and sidechain techniques, it optimises liquidity and facilitates swift state transitions.
Celer cBridge
cBridge v1 has been released on Celer’s mainnet, enabling users to transfer tokens across multiple blockchains, such as Ethereum, Arbitrum, Polygon, and Binance Smart Chain.
However, bridge solutions frequently utilise Ethereum as the primary intermediary. To illustrate, let’s consider that you are trying to move USDC from Polygon to Arbitrum. First, you must switch from Polygon to Ethereum, then from Ethereum to your target source.
Still, when working on Multichain, cBridge offers streamlining asset movement, which promotes the user experience (UX) and saves time.
A user on the Arbitrum roll-up, built on Ethereum, can send funds to a user on Polkadot using various cBridges. These cBridges facilitate the transfer by routing liquidity from Arbitrum to the Optimism Roll-up, then to layer-1 Ethereum. The process involves multiple hops across the Celer State Channel Network, situated on top of layer-1 Ethereum, before finally reaching Polkadot. Remarkably, this entire transaction can occur within milliseconds, taking advantage of the speed of light at a minimal cost.
What is the CERL token?
CERL is the native ERC-20 token of the Celer Network built on the Ethereum blockchain. CERL can be used to enable payments for dealing with blockchain transactions, serving in various incentive systems, and covering transaction fees for off-chain service providers. Additionally, traders can use CERL to stake in the SGN to become the state guardians.
CELR has a maximum supply of 10 billion tokens, with 25% reserved for PoLC mining rewards and ecosystem building, 17% for foundation, 20% for the team, 5% for marketing, and 33% for sale. Seed sales comprise 11.5% of the total supply, and private sale accounts for 15.5%.
Statistically, the private sale that occurred in August 2018 raised $23.255M. The launchpad sales constitute 6% of the total supply, resulting in a comprehensive fundraising of around $4M. In March 2019, CELR tokens were sold on Binance Launchpad. Key liquid trading pairs for CELR include CELR/USDT, CELR/BTC, CELR/BUSD, and CELR/BNB.
